Christophe Leroy <christophe.leroy@xxxxxx> writes:

> In ITLB miss handled the line supposed to clear bits 20-23 on the
> L2 ITLB entry is buggy and does indeed nothing, leading to undefined
> value which could allow execution when it shouldn't.
>
> Properly do the clearing with the relevant instruction.

Looks a valid change.
rlwimi r10, r10, 0, 0x0f00 means:
r10 = ((r10 << 0) & 0x0f00) | (r10 & ~0x0f00) which ends up being
r10 = r10

On ISA, rlwinm is recommended for clearing high order bits.
rlwinm r10, r10, 0, ~0x0f00 means:
r10 = (r10 << 0) & ~0x0f00

Which does exactly what the comments suggests.
